Transaction 348b5855cce36f5be94dd932eec029523fc0de1839f4d32b398d3bc58aeb0f7a

1 Input
2 Outputs
  • 348b5855cce36f5be94dd932eec029523fc0de1839f4d32b398d3bc58aeb0f7a:0
  • value  50442268
    address  3AteAcyHhkXM6VrjxhresTfZQaFfa7uaCL
  • 348b5855cce36f5be94dd932eec029523fc0de1839f4d32b398d3bc58aeb0f7a:1
  • value  2527646
    address  32QpB2uQKAWpabGBphvBtqvLFN4b2gYep8